Things You Must Know About Ecommerce Hosting

Undoubtedly, Electronic Commerce (or ecommerce in short) is the greatest gift of the advancements in web technology. Ecommerce allows merchants of all classes and business lines to trade electronically in a secured environment. Ecommerce has no boundaries. Merchants find it easy to get newer clients everyday internationally. The successes of EBay and Amazon websites underscore the stupendous credibility of ecommerce as a trading platform.

Merchants participating in ecommerce need a secure ecommerce website and ecommerce hosting services. Ecommerce hosting is a lucrative business in which a company provides all kinds of facilities by which a merchant can sell wares to a global clientele over the Internet. The facilities needed for ecommerce are (but not limited to) the following:

  • A high capacity web server
  • Ecommerce website design (including cataloging services)
  • Software for electronic shopping carts, and to accept, process and confirm sales orders
  • Providing templates for building virtual storefronts / online catalogs
  • Managing secure e-payment mechanism
  • Inventory control

A merchant gets in touch with an ecommerce service provider in order to procure space in its web server. Space in web servers are usually rented out on a monthly or yearly basis. Simultaneously, software for processing online orders is also leased out to the merchant.

There are two modes of service – dedicated and shared. Commonly, an ecommerce hosting company’s servers cater to the requirements of more than one merchant on a shared basis. If the web traffic of a merchant is considerably large, and it suffers because of shared operation, it may opt for dedicated servers. The service providers usually assist merchants in opening up Internet e-payment accounts. These accounts are bank accounts capable of Internet transactions through Visa, MasterCard, American Express and other credit card companies.

The ecommerce hosting service providers are capable of managing the technical nitty-gritty behind the day-to-day maintenance of a commercial web server. For start-ups and smaller companies, opting for an ecommerce host is an economically viable option. These companies can avoid expenditure in costly servers, software connectivity. Moreover, they can escape the burden behind continued maintenance and upkeep of these components for ensuring a 24×7 service. Reliability is the essence of ecommerce hosting service providers. A reliable host should be ready to extend support even during off-peak hours. A merchant cannot afford to lose business on account of a server that has gone down all of a sudden.
For a successful electronic commerce business, it is mandatory to choose a trustworthy hosting partner. The service provider should have goodwill in the market. This in turn is essential to establish your goodwill and credibility in the ecommerce world. Ecommerce merchants should give due importance to the insecurity of internet shoppers about leakage of their credit card details while transacting over the web. Today, hacking of financially sensitive credit card information is not at all uncommon. A credible host capable of providing a robust, secured e-payment platform can alleviate the shoppers’ fear to a great extent.

Typically, a credible ecommerce host offers the following services:

  • 24x7x365 service and technical support to ecommerce merchants
  • Live chat, email support at all times, preferably a human support most of the times
  • Fully automated, comprehensive package to track web traffic
  • Shopping cart software
  • Periodic database backups to ensure business continuity
  • Upgrade facility to better ecommerce packages in sync with growing business needs
  • Provision of secured server, with latest anti-virus and anti-hacking tools
  • Support for scripting and server-side programming
  • Instant switching to backup server in case the master server crashes or during server maintenance

A merchant should do thorough research before selecting an ecommerce host. The hosting charge varies from one service provider to another and depends on the service package you opt for and the quality of support you expect. There are some free ecommerce service providers also. However, their services are unreliable and insecure. These free ecommerce hosting provides make money in different ways – mostly through online ads. The flop side of free providers is their unstable service. It has been observed that free hosting service providers stop functioning abruptly within months or even weeks of commencement of their operations.

A merchant should search for dependable ecommerce hosts over the internet and eventually narrow down the list into two or three. One way to check credibility of the hosts is to visit and study carefully the sites that are currently supported by these companies. The primary expectations can be summed up into two generic requirements – reliability and customer service. No hosting company under the sun can guarantee a 100% uptime, however, today, in the age of advanced hardware and software technologies, 99.9% uninterrupted service level can be achieved. The most important reliability factor is how quickly a service provider can spring back to service in case of a downtime. In real life, unexpected interruptions do happen and credible ecommerce hosts have to invest considerably to ensure business continuity. What’s more important is – host companies should have preventive mechanism in place for prompt restoration of services in cases of disasters like flood, fire, earthquake etc.

Finding The Best Hosting Service

If you have just finished your website design and eagerly waiting to hit the web, finding the best web hosting service at the right price is the last hurdle you need to cross. Today, the website hosting market is replete with umpteen hosting companies, each promising to outclass the other with a plethora of services at the cheapest rate. Web masters find it really difficult to find the fittest one among the lot. This article will help you to select the right hosting company by considering several criteria.

The very first thing you need is to assess your requirements. Let us illustrate this. The hosting requirements for a personal website will differ largely from that of a corporate or a product website. The requirement for server space and other software and hardware support will be minimal for a personal webpage, while these requirements will be significantly greater in case of a corporate or an ecommerce website. You need to take into account your present hosting needs, as well as what you expect in the near future.

The next thing that will come into your mind is the website hosting rate. Different hosting companies offer differing rates. If a hosting company offers dedicated servers, then its service charges will naturally shoot up. On the other side, companies that offer cheap hosting services on a shared basis with limited bandwidth will naturally charge less. The point here is – if you are planning to host a personal website or a fun / game website without any commercial objective, you may settle for the cheap ones. On the other hand, if you are planning to host a site, such as a corporate /product/ecommerce site, with serious business intent, then you should not settle for free or cheap ones. After all, you cannot put your reputation and credibility at stake for the saving of a few bucks. You should first evaluate every other criterion and finally select one based on rate from a shortlist of two to three.

Reliability and speed is another crucial factor. Today, a best hosting company has the ability to guarantee 99% or a little more uptime (though 100% can never be guaranteed). Wide bandwidth should ensure smooth flow of web traffic and satisfied visitors to your site. Hosting companies that are technically equipped to enter into a business continuity agreement and have multiple servers on standby for recovery from disasters (say, fire, flood, and earthquake etc.) are certainly credible. These are all the more important for continued hassle-free hosting of commercial sites.

The next important factor to watch out for is the data transfer rate and disk space allotted to you. Website hosting companies have to pay for the bandwidth they consume, and in turn, they will bill proportionate amounts to you – the client. It is wise to pay upfront the amount for the expected data transfer. Otherwise, you might be bombarded with a surprise bill. Another important but related decision is to decide upon the required disk space and reserve that. Note that most websites require a space less than 3 GB.

The extent of technical support provided by the hosting company is another crucial determinant for the success of your web service. The best hosting support possible is 24x7x365. In this competitive age, this has become the most desired service level. You cannot allow your visitors (and therefore your business to suffer) because of downtime. You can take a surprise check of the promised service by shooting off an email at the odd hour.

Certain websites require support on special features. Evaluate carefully whether your host can accommodate special support for a variety of scripts, database, shopping carts and secure servers. Support for desired DBMS (Database Management System) in tandem with your growing business needs is another crucial judgment criterion.

Last, but not the least, you should judge a host on the basis of freedom to control your site to some extent. As a webmaster, it is not feasible to turn to the hosting company’s support chain to address every trivial requirement like changing passwords and email addresses. There should be an administrative control panel for your website under your control.

Let us now share a few thoughts about web hosting plans available in the website hosting market. Typically, there are three types of hosting packages available for you to choose from: discount web hosting, Windows web hosting, and Linux web hosting. Discount web hosting or Cheap web hosting is most suitable for start-ups. Start-ups and small companies generally have limited funding and tend to opt for the discount web hosting services with a low price tag. Generally, the package ranges from $5 to $6 a month. The best discount web hosting deal should not cross the $10 a month mark. If you have a little more money, you can easily opt for a Windows or a Linux hosting plan. Such plans are sufficient to cater to all your day-to-day website maintenance requirements. A Windows plan typically offers support for ASP and MSSQL. Basic Windows and Linux plans are available in the range of $10 to $15. If you have more requirements like greater disk space, increased bandwidth, and other requirements, the price tag will rise accordingly.

Discover What To Look In A Cheap Hosting Company

Cheap hosting can be a good way to get a bargain. It would make sense to know what to look in a cheap hosting company before you opt for the hosting servers. If you want to start an online business, then you need a cheap web host to make your business lucrative. It is also advisable to investigate a cheap web hosting company vigilantly and find if it will be suitable for your online business.

The suitable cheap web hosting company will not be found in a day – the ideal cheap website hosting company will require your time, perseverance and research. There are lots of cheap hosting companies that offer excellent service, so it makes no sense to pay a whole lot of money for web hosting – it can come to you cheap and good.

The Essentials

The first thing that you should look for in a cheap web hosting company is the availability of the server. Remember poor servers cause poor hosting, so the servers from cheap hosting company have to be openly available all the time. This is essential as you do not know when your customer will be visiting your website and reading the information on the webpage and ultimately get buying your product. If the visitor receives a server error page when he/she wants to buy a product, then in all probability your business loses a prospective buyer.

The website-hosting servers should also take very little time to load the website pages. This is the age of the high speed Internet, so nobody will be waiting for long to get the web pages loaded. Do not let the visitors go for the faster websites – make your option better by having a good web hosting company that gets the loading done very fast.

Another key to knowing a good cheap web hosting company is that the time-period the company has been around in business. If a cheap web host has been around with its hosting service for more than 5 years and is doing well, then you can be assured that you can rely on it. It will be a good bet for your online business to run successfully.

Make sure that the cheap hosting company is a well-managed one. A web hosting company that is well managed will keep you free from the troubles of up-keeping complicated server technology and will be responsible for proper technical maintenance. This will make way for you to focus on your online business and you can leave the technical stuff for the web-hosting support professional.

The common features you need to look for in a web hosting company:

  • control panel is an interface that allows you to access your website on the web server. Here, you have the options of setting up, updating as well as customizing your website.
  • The bandwidth is also necessary in cheap website hosting for the visitors to make requests for files on your website and downloading them to their personal computers.
  • Make sure you have enough disk space for further growth and elaboration plans on your website. It is essential to go for a cheap web host that has a bigger plan, if you need to upgrade your website and your online business.
  • Look for an account that has a database. You will need it if you have to store dynamically accessible data like Interactive news, user accounts, message boards, stock prices, forum and maps.
  • Check the scripting language– the top web hosting companies use Unix and Linux platform, and the languages used are PHP, PERL and CGI. It is necessary to get a cheap web host that supports the latest version for the purpose of maximizing the latest web technologies and all this should come for the fee that you need to pay.
  • A good customer support system is vital even if you are a novice or an expert in web hosting. If the database is huge, then you do not need any direct assistance from the customer support system, however, if you are too lazy to get the answers you can opt for the direct customer support service. The direct customer support can come in the forms of phone support, email support, as well as live chat support.

A cheap web hosting company should also have a good marketing strategy. A web host should come with enough existing members and there should be steady growth of new members. To put it in a gist, when you are entering in a deal with a cheap web hosting company, look into the 6 factors – service, speed, uptime, reliability, guarantee and price. If you are satisfied with these six factors then you can be assured that the cheap hosting would provide high quality and ideal service.
